Studies On The Extraction,Purification And Activities Of Peptidoglycan From Actinoplanes Sp. Fermentation Residue

Actinoplanes sp.was commomly used in the production of hypoglycemic agents-Acarbose.Meanwhile,a large amount of fermentation residue was discharged from this process.The traditional treatment of residues was complicated and with high cost.Active components were found with large quantities in the fermentation residue.Therefore,it is of great value to develop an efficient extraction method to obtain active ingredients in the residue.This paper is devoted to the extraction,separation and biological activity evaluation of peptidoglycan from the fermentation residues of Actinoplanes sp.,providing a good prospect for the reusing of bio-pharmaceutical wastes.1)Based on the single factor tests,the response surface methodology(RSM)was used for optimizing mechanochemical extraction processing of peptidoglycan from Actinoplanes sp.The results of the optimum milling conditions were as follows: NaOH(6%),ball to power weight ratio(15),rotation speed(300 rpm),milling time(5 min).The orthogonal experiment was used to optimize the protein-depositing method.The optimum conditions were as follows: rotation speed(300 rpm),SDS(17%),ball to power weight ratio(15),milling time(30 min).Finally,a simple,time-saving and low cost extraction route was obtained.The obtained extract was confirmed to be peptidoglycans by lysozyme dissolution test,infrared spectroscopy and chemical composition analysis and so on.2)The extract obtained in part 1 was used as raw material to obtain purified soluble peptidoglycan component SPG-1 by enzymolysis of lysozyme and semi-preparative liquid phase.Immunization and antitumor activities of the component SPG-1 were studied.The results were as follows: The proliferation of splenic lymphocytes in rats showed that SPG-1 had significant proliferative effects on T and B lymphocytes.In vitro stimulation of macrophages indicated that the SPG-1 could stimulate the production of IL-10,IL-12 and TNF-? by macrophages,and the anti-tumor test results illustrated that SPG-1 has a good inhibitory effect on cancer cells,such as HT29 colon cancer cells,Eca-109 esophageal cancer cells and Hep G2 liver cancer cells.
